|  | /* | 
|  | Computes "num_motions" candidate global motion parameters between two frames. | 
|  | The array "params_by_motion" should be length 8 * "num_motions". The ordering | 
|  | of each set of parameters is best described  by the homography: | 
|  |  | 
|  | [x'     (m2 m3 m0   [x | 
|  | z .  y'  =   m4 m5 m1 *  y | 
|  | 1]      m6 m7 1)    1] | 
|  |  | 
|  | where m{i} represents the ith value in any given set of parameters. | 
|  |  | 
|  | "num_inliers" should be length "num_motions", and will be populated with the | 
|  | number of inlier feature points for each motion. Params for which the | 
|  | num_inliers entry is 0 should be ignored by the caller. | 
|  | */ | 
|  | int compute_global_motion_feature_based( | 
|  | TransformationType type, YV12_BUFFER_CONFIG *frm, YV12_BUFFER_CONFIG *ref, | 
|  | #if CONFIG_HIGHBITDEPTH | 
|  | int bit_depth, | 
|  | #endif | 
|  | int *num_inliers_by_motion, double *params_by_motion, int num_motions); |
